Alerts, advisories and recalls
A health alert advises the Victorian community of an issue that is urgent, poses an immediate threat to public health and requires an immediate response.
A health advisory is less urgent than an alert and provides advice to the health sector and Victorian public.
A heat health alert is issued when forecast heatwave conditions are likely to impact human health.
